Trail Overview

A beautiful wooded trail along the Shriner Mountain ridge. The trail is mostly rocky, becoming slightly rougher as you go. Enjoy the solitude of this out-and-back adventure through dense evergreen growth, clearings, and some possible mud. There is a large turnaround area at the end, which is also a very peaceful place to pause for a few minutes. Barner Gap Trail (hiking trail) intersects Old Tar Road about 3/4 of the way to the turn-around.

Difficulty

The trail becomes progressively rougher as it goes. Several potential muddy areas and ruts/dips in the road.
